cpqDaLogDrvMultipathAccess

OBJECT-TYPE
1.3.6.1.4.1.232.3.2.3.1.1.18
Access
read-only
Status
mandatory
Sub-identifiers
0
Logical Drive Multi-path Access. This indicates whether all the physical disks including spares of this logical drive have been configured to have and currently still have more than one I/O path to the controller. The following values are valid: Other (1) Indicates that the instrument agent can not determine if this logical drive has multi-path access. Not Supported (2) Indicates that multi-path access to this logical drive is not supported. Not Configured (3) Indicates that this logical drive is not configured to have multi-path access. Path Redundant (4) Indicates that all disks of this logical drive currently have more than one I/O path to the controller. No Redundant Path (5) Indicates that all disks of this logical drive previously had more than one I/O path to the controller, but now one or few of them have no redundant I/O path.
INTEGER { other(1), notSupported(2), notConfigured(3), pathRedundant(4), noRedundantPath(5) }
